腾讯云网站解决方案帮您轻松应对建站成本高/网络不稳等常见问题

[SEO] NodeJS将有望使用微软的ChakraCore JavaScript引擎驱动

3
回复
1218
查看
[复制链接]

765

主题

779

帖子

3万

积分

董事

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72Rank: 72

积分
33029
发表于 19-4-7 14:42:24 | 显示全部楼层 |阅读模式      紫钻仅向指定用户开放  
    最近微软的工程师提交了一份 Pull request 到nodejs:master主分支,希望将微软自家的ChakraCore JavaScript解析引擎添加到Node.JS的核心中。除了Google的V8解析器,Node.JS的底层JavaScript解释器有望多一种选择。
& o& l- {; S. D6 G" o$ }. s2 d注* ChakraCore 是微软开源的Microsoft Edge 浏览器Chakra JavaScript 引擎的核心部分,主要用于Microsoft Edge 和Windows 中HTML/CSS/JavaScript 编写的应用。 ChakraCore 支持x86/x64/ARM 架构JavaScript 的Just-in-time (JIT) 编译,垃圾收集和大量的最新JavaScript 特性。. e2 N3 a6 J' X5 n; D
微软的工程师 kunalspathak 表示: ( K5 h; @. o8 }" H& `/ e/ U
在启动Node.JS时可选择微软的ChakraCore JavaScript引擎。+ ]; R9 W! N) ]- u+ [. P' O
我们对V8引擎的API进行了适配(shim),这些适配实现的API,将能够支持在V8中实现的原生插件和模块,0 i- \6 T" u4 R* r; W4 Z$ f% }% u5 l
下面是提交(commits) 的总结:& B3 U0 w. N. K9 s* L
chakrashim源代码! S  k( a) O, o/ W5 G
ChakraCore v1.1.0.1源代码5 J* l) Y% Z6 J% m- F
Build脚本的改动来构建chakrashim和ChakraCore$ s: I! q& C: n; N7 }6 H& l
NodeJS源代码的修改使之能在ChakraCore上运行: ]: _+ _. g7 ?: I$ L) @! O
ChakraCore的单元测试更新! [3 W9 r2 m! v4 e$ m- E4 J8 H& I
对此NodeJS的主要维护者表示,此merge非常宠大,需要花大量时间进行代码审查。

0

主题

3

帖子

20

积分

1°伸手党

Rank: 2

积分
20
发表于 19-11-7 23:00:36 | 显示全部楼层         
不错不错,楼主您辛苦了。。。
回复

使用道具 举报

0

主题

7

帖子

4

积分

1°伸手党

Rank: 2

积分
4
发表于 19-12-16 15:53:07 | 显示全部楼层         
看帖回帖是美德!
回复

使用道具 举报

0

主题

9

帖子

4

积分

1°伸手党

Rank: 2

积分
4
发表于 19-12-23 03:09:01 | 显示全部楼层         
路过,支持一下啦
回复

使用道具 举报

网站简介

球球发,是一家 Discuz! 商业插件、风格模板、网站源码、 Discuz!运营维护技术等于一体的交流分享网站,全站95%的资源都是免费下载,对于资源我们是每天更新,每个亲测资源最新最全---球球发(如果我们有侵犯了您权益的资源请联系我们删除